Long, long ago I mentioned a new Strider was in the works. Let’s see…here it is. Well, I wasn’t lying – GRIN, who developed the Bionic Commando Rearmed/revival, were on the job, but it was canned when GRIN closed up shop. Here’s what it was panning out like.
The PS Vita version of Street Fighter x Tekken is being delayed some, but it will feature 12 new characters. XD Likely these will be DLC for the console versions. The Street Fighter additions will be Sakura, Blanka, Cody, Guy, Dudley and Street Fighter 3′s Elena, with Jack, Lei, Christy, Lars, Bryan and Alisa.
